JS补充24

2018-08-20  本文已影响0人  常婧帅

查看元素的几何尺寸

domEle.getBoundingClientRect();

兼容性很好

该方法返回一个对象,对象里面有left top right bottom等属性,left和top代表该元素左上角的x和y坐标,right和bottom代表元素右下角的x和y的坐标。

height和width属性老版本IE并没有实现。

返回的结果并不是"实时的"

查看元素的尺寸

dom.offsetWidth,dom.offsetHeight

查看元素的位置

dom.offsetLeft,dom.offsetTop

对于无定位元素,返回相对文档的坐标,对于定位的父级的元素,返回相当于最近有定位的父级的坐标。

dom.offsetParent

返回最近有定位的父级,如无,返回body。body.offsetParent返回null。

上一篇 下一篇

猜你喜欢

热点阅读